Spectral Gaps vs the Baum-Connes Conjecture
Offered By: Banach Center via YouTube
Course Description
Overview
Explore the intriguing relationship between spectral gaps and the Baum-Connes conjecture in this 42-minute lecture delivered by Piotr Nowak at the Banach Center. Delve into the mathematical intricacies of these concepts and gain insights into their connections and implications in the field of functional analysis and operator algebras.
